Simplify the expression and combine like terms.
​2 (x+6) + 3x + 4

Answer:

5x + 16

Step-by-step explanation:

​2 (x+6) + 3x + 4

Simplify:

2x + 12 + 3x + 4

Combine like terms:

(2x + 3x) + (4 + 12) = 5x + 16
